Step 4 Enter the publisher node connectivity information and choose OK. The system checks for network connectivity. If you chose to pause the system after the system successfully verifies network connectivity, the Successful Connection to First Node window displays. Choose Continue. Note If the network connectivity test fails, the system always stops and allows you to go back and reenter the parameter information. The SMTP Host Configuration window displays. Step 5 If you want to configure an SMTP server, choose Yes and enter the SMTP server name. Note To use certain operating system features, you must configure an SMTP server; however, you can also configure an SMTP server later by using the operating system GUI or the command line interface. The Platform Configuration Confirmation window displays. Step 6 Choose OK to start installing the software or choose Back to change the configuration. Step 7 When the installation process completes, you get prompted to log in by using the Administrator account and password.
